1. Determinant
The determinant is a scalar value associated with a square matrix. It is denoted by |A| or det(A).
Determinant is defined only for square matrices.
2. Determinant of a 2×2 Matrix

3. Determinant of a 3×3 Matrix
For a 3×3 matrix, determinant can be evaluated using expansion along any row or column.

|A| = a(ei − fh) − b(di − fg) + c(dh − eg)
4. Important Properties of Determinants
• Interchanging two rows (or columns) changes the sign of determinant
• If two rows (or columns) are identical, determinant = 0
• If one row is a multiple of another, determinant = 0
• Determinant of identity matrix = 1
